As the eyes of the world turn to Sochi, Russia for the Olympic and Paralympic Winter Games, Lakeshore is bringing the Spirit of Sochi to Birmingham, Alabama. For the first time in history, the Paralympic Games will be significantly televised on NBC in the United States. As a leader in the Paralympic movement as demonstrated by our designation as a U.S. Olympic and Paralympic Training Site and Paralympic Sport Club, it is Lakeshore’s honor to host the first U.S. community-wide celebration and viewing of the Paralympic Opening Ceremony broadcast.
Lakeshore is internationally recognized for its significant contributions to the Paralympic movement including the most recent distinction of receiving the prestigious Rings of Gold award from the USOC in 2013. We will set the standard by hosting an amazing community celebration to promote the 2014 Winter Paralympic Games. Held inside Lakeshore’s centrally located 129,000 square foot facility, Spirit of Sochi attendees will enjoy:
- “Road to Sochi”—the official USOC traveling interactive tour featuring 12 different Winter sports. This is the only stop for the tour during the Paralympic Games.
- BIG screen broadcast of the Paralympic Opening Ceremony from Sochi
- Birmingham’s Best Food Trucks
- Olympians and Paralympians Autograph Booth
- Sochi Samples—cultural treats bringing the city of Sochi to Birmingham
- Ready for Rio!—an exhibition of wheelchair rugby with a spicy taste of what’s to come in the 2016 Summer Games
- Videos of Olympic and Paralympic highlights
